Registry Cleaning and Optimization

The Windows registry is like the brain of your operating system—storing settings, preferences, and hardware configurations. Over time, it gets cluttered with obsolete entries from uninstalled programs, failed updates, or corrupted installations.

A system mechanic scans and removes these invalid entries, reducing system lag and preventing crashes. According to Microsoft, a bloated registry can slow boot times by up to 30%.

  • Removes orphaned keys
  • Fixes incorrect file paths
  • Optimizes registry structure for faster access

Tools like iolo System Mechanic use patented registry repair technology to ensure safety and performance.

Disk Cleanup and Junk File Removal

Every time you browse the web, download files, or install apps, your system accumulates junk: cache files, logs, thumbnails, and temporary downloads. These files can consume gigabytes of space and slow down your system.

A system mechanic identifies and removes these unnecessary files without affecting your personal data. It goes beyond Windows’ built-in Disk Cleanup by targeting hidden junk in system folders, browser caches, and application logs.

  • Clears browser history and cookies
  • Deletes Windows update leftovers
  • Removes temporary files from Adobe, Microsoft Office, and other apps

Startup Program Management

Most users unknowingly install apps that launch at startup—cloud sync tools, updaters, chat apps—each adding seconds to boot time. A system mechanic analyzes these programs and lets you disable non-essential ones with a single click.

  • Lists all startup items with resource impact
  • Recommends which apps to disable
  • Allows selective enable/disable without breaking functionality

Defragmentation and Disk Optimization

On traditional HDDs, files get scattered across the disk over time, forcing the read head to jump around. This fragmentation slows down data access. A system mechanic automatically defragments your drive, arranging files contiguously for faster retrieval.

For SSDs, which don’t need defragmentation, the tool runs TRIM commands to maintain write performance and longevity.

  • Automatically schedules defragmentation
  • Optimizes file placement for faster access
  • Applies SSD-specific optimizations

Myth: Registry Cleaning Is Dangerous

Yes, poorly designed tools can break your system by deleting critical registry keys. However, top-tier system mechanic software creates backups before making changes and uses intelligent scanning to avoid harmful deletions.

Always choose tools with restore points and rollback features.
